Plumbing Project Manager
Job Summary:
We are seeking a dynamic and analytical Plumbing Project Manager to join our team. In this role, you will oversee all aspects of a plumbing project, from planning and budgeting to execution and completion, ensuring the project is delivered on time, within budget, and according to specifications by coordinating with clients, managing schedules, resource allocation, quality control, and risk mitigation throughout the construction process.

Responsibilities
Planning and Budgeting: Develop detailed project plans, timelines, and budgets, including estimating labor, materials, and equipment costs. Drive financial health of project to include change orders.
Contract Administration: Manage contracts with and vendors, ensuring adherence to terms and conditions.
Site Supervision: Monitor construction activities on-site, ensuring compliance with project plans, safety regulations, and quality standards.
Progress Monitoring: Track project progress against the schedule, identify potential delays, and implement corrective actions.
Team Management: Lead and manage a team of plumbing professionals, including supervisors, foremen, and subcontractors, assigning tasks and delegating responsibilities.
Risk Management: Identify and mitigate potential risks associated with the project, including weather conditions, material availability, regulatory changes, and safety.
Communication: Facilitate clear communication among stakeholders, GC management, and subcontractors.
Quality Control: Implement quality assurance procedures to ensure project meets specified standards.
Reporting: Prepare regular progress reports for clients and upper management, including budget updates and project status.
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in project management, engineering, or a related field is preferred.
5‑10 years experience in Plumbing or Fire Protection project management is required.
Strong leadership and crisis resolution skills.
Familiar with Microsoft Excel and ProCore software.
Ability to break large projects into small steps.
